Stop SQL Server. To do this, pressCtrl+Cat the Command Prompt window, restart SQL Server as a service, and then verify the size of thetempdb.mdfandtemplog.ldffiles. Use the DBCC SHRINKDATABASE command DBCC SHRIN
继续介绍更多常用的 SQL Server DBCC 命令及其功能: DBCC SHOWCONTIG: 显示指定表或索引的碎片信息。 sqlCopy Code DBCC SHOWCONTIG ('MyTable', 'MyIndex'); DBCC SHRINKDATABASE: 缩小指定数据库的数据和日志文件大小。 sqlCopy Code DBCC SHRINKDATABASE ('MyDatabase', 10); DBCC SHRINKFILE: 缩小指定数据库...
Syntaxe pour SQL Server : syntaxsql Copie DBCC SHRINKDATABASE ( database_name | database_id | 0 [ , target_percent ] [ , { NOTRUNCATE | TRUNCATEONLY } ] ) [ WITH { [ WAIT_AT_LOW_PRIORITY [ ( <wait_at_low_priority_option_list> )] ] [ , NO_INFOMSGS] } ] < wait_at_lo...
To shrink all data and log files for a specific database, execute theDBCC SHRINKDATABASEcommand. To shrink one data or log file at a time for a specific database, execute theDBCC SHRINKFILEcommand. To view the current amount of free (unallocated) space in the database, runsp_spaceused. ...
1、AUTO_SHRINK 基本格式: ALTER DATABASE database_name SET AUTO_SHRINK ON 1. 将该选项设为ON后,数据库引擎会自动收缩具有可用空间的数据库。 2、DBCC SHRINKDATABASE 基本格式: DBCC SHRINKDATABASE('database_name',target_percent) 1. 该方式要求手动收缩数据库大小,比自动化收缩数据库更灵活,可对整个数...
DBCC SHRINKDATABASE(db_id,int) ---收缩指定数据库的数据文件和日志文件大小 DBCC SHRINKFILE(file_name,int) ---收缩相关数据库的指定数据文件和日志文件大小 杂项语句 DBCC dllname (FREE) ---查看加载的扩展PROC在内存中卸载指定的扩展过程动态链接库(dll) DBCC HELP...
ALTER DATABASE是提供对默认tempdb文件(tempdev和templog)大小的完整控制。 DBCC SHRINKDATABASE否在数据库级别运行。 DBCC SHRINKFILE否允许收缩单个文件。 SQL Server Management Studio否通过图形用户界面收缩数据库文件。 注解 默认情况下,tempdb数据库配置为根据需要自动增长。 因此,此数据库可能会意外地增长到...
Shrinking a Database using T-SQL To perform a shrink operation using T-SQL, you can use theDBCC SHRINKDATABASEorDBCC SHRINKFILEcommand. Shrinking a Database using DBCC SHRINKDATABASE DBCCSHRINKDATABASE(DatabaseName) 1. ReplaceDatabaseNamewith the name of the target database. ...
-- Shrink database data space allocated.DBCC SHRINKDATABASE (N'database_name'); 在Azure SQL 数据库中,一个数据库可能包含一个或多个数据文件,这些文件是在数据增长时自动创建的。 若要确定数据库的文件布局,包括每个文件的已使用和已分配的大小,请使用以下示例脚本查询sys.database_files目录视图: ...
在Azure Data Studio 中打开笔记本 选项2:手动执行步骤 本文讨论对已满事务日志可以采取的几种应对措施,并就以后如何避免出现已满事务日志给出建议。 事务日志已满时,SQL Server 数据库引擎会发出9002 错误。 当数据库联机或恢复时,日志可能会满。 如果日志在数据库处于联机状态时已满,则该数据...